Abstract
A new approach to enhance the compression performance and execution time of chaos-based joint compression and encryption schemes is proposed. Instead of finding a new method to update the Look-up Table (LUT) in each iteration or using a different method to represent the ciphertext, we use multiple LUTs based on the conditional bi-gram probabilities of two consecutive source symbols occurring in the input. This high order probability model can represent the characteristics of whole input file more accurately. As a result, it will further decrease the search time as well as the length of the resultant ciphertext. Simulation results also verify that the proposed approach does lead to better compression performance and execution efficiency.
